Here is a brief overview of the history of car keys as we understand them:

Basic mechanical keys: These are traditional keys without security encoding, that lock and unlock your car and turn on the ignition with the press of a button. They are usually made of metal and can be duplicated by locksmiths.

Remote keys They are operated by a battery-powered key fob that includes buttons that control the security system of your vehicle. When the buttons on the key fob are pressed, an radio transmitter transmits a radio frequency code from the vehicle's receiver. If the code matches the car's response, it will react in a similar manner. These keys can also be programmed to work with a specific car if it's lost or stolen.

Transponder keys were introduced in the 1990s they feature grooves on both sides of the key, making it more difficult for thieves to copy or duplicate.  skoda key reset  use them and a locksmith can program them to work with your vehicle.

Proximity Keys: These keys are similar to remote keys, but they allow you to open your doors and start your engine without the need to insert the keys into the ignition or lock. The key fob communicates via low-frequency with your car to open doors and activate useful features like Welcome Motion.

Display keys Keys with display: This key made by BMW that features a small touchscreen LCD and provides additional functionality to the standard remote key fob. It has all the functions of keys that are remotes that you can imagine: locking, unlocking, keyless start. However, you can also park your car from a distance or control your climate system by using the screen.

You will save money and time when you change your keys. The first step is to identify the kind of car key you require. There are many different types of car keys that include traditional keys, remote key fobs and smart keys.

The classic car key is a mechanical device that locks the doors and is inserted into the ignition. It is the most affordable kind of car key to replace and is only about $10 to $12. Remote key fobs are remotes which allow you to lock or unlock your vehicle from a distance. It will cost you around $20 to replace.

Transponder keys feature a specific immobilizer chip inside that links to your vehicle's computer system. These keys are priced between $100-$250 to replace. Smart keys are those that use proximity sensors that can open doors and even start the car with just a single press. They are the most expensive to replace, and can cost up to $500 or more.
